Course Description

This course is designed to provide students with an understanding of confined spaces and the ability to recognize hazards associated with working in a confined space environment. This course will meet the Workers Safety Compensation Commission Act and Regulations regarding confined space entry.

Course Outline

1.0 Confined Space Entry (CSE)
2.0 Confined Space Entry Program
3.0 Hazards of Confined Spaces
4.0 Hazard Assessment
5.0 Atmospheric Testing
6.0 Control Methods for Hazardous Atmospheres
7.0 Confined Space Entry Work Permit System
8.0 Personal Protective Equipment (PPE)
9.0 Rescue Planning
10.0 Accident/Incident Reporting
11.0 Case Studies
